Heartburn begins as a burning pain behind the breastbone and it then usually radiates upward to the neck. There is often a sensation of food coming back into the mouth and is accompanied by a sour or bitter taste in the mouth.

GERD (Gastroesophageal reflux Disease) Can Affect the Results of a DWI Breath Test






www.russmanlaw.com - GERD or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ease is a condition where the body has a difficult time with digestion. GERD can affect a DWI breath test and may elevate your blood alcohol level.
